Q: How do per-tenant rate quotas work on the Skylarch platform?
A: Each tenant gets a baseline quota enforced at the edge proxy, with burst credits that refill hourly. Contractors should never raise quotas directly; file a change request through the Brindle queue instead. If you need to inspect the quota ledger itself, it lives in a sealed admin store, and read access is granted only after entering the recovery passphrase below.

vault phrase of tajef-tafog = istox-sorax-zorox-casok-holox-kelix-weneth-drueth-casion

Handover: Orphan Sweeper (Grayfen)

Welcome aboard. The Grayfen sweeper runs nightly and deletes cloud resources with no owning tag. It has a dry-run mode — keep it on until you've watched two full cycles. The exclusion list lives in the ops repo; edit it before tagging anything experimental. Sweeper state is stored in an encrypted bucket. To unseal that bucket after a restart, use the passphrase noted just below.

unlock words, kagef-taduf: fenir-quenix-norwyn-sorvan-gormir-gorir-fraok

- [ ] **SDK parity check (Marrowkit Swift / Marrowkit Kotlin):** Confirm both SDKs expose identical method signatures for the v4 plugin hooks, including the deprecated-but-supported batch callbacks. Run the parity matrix script and attach its report. Plugin authors should target only releases stamped with the verified build shown below.

build token for kahop-kagep: htk6_72fc45

Hey, new on-call! Quick notes on Acrostica, our crossword generator. The fill engine runs as a batch worker; if puzzles stop generating, it's almost always the dictionary sync job wedging on the Wordhoard service. Restart the worker first, then check Wordhoard's queue depth. Don't panic about partial grids — they retry cleanly. You'll need access to Wordhoard's internal API to drain the queue manually. Authenticate those drain calls with the key right below this paragraph.

gateway credential: kto3_qfe

Migration step 4 — Tumblewick locker access flow. Swap the legacy PIN table for token-based grants. Run the backfill job first; it maps existing PINs to short-lived tokens. Door controllers poll the new grants table, so no firmware push needed. Flag any lockers still on firmware v2 to the Harrowgate team. After backfill, point the access service at the grants store using the connection string below.

replica DSN, kajep-yahag: mssql://praok_svc:iF@db-8d68.plorvaio.local:5432/eliion